Edinburgh deserves a more ambitious Low Emission Zone

SNP and Labour councillors have again backed a city centre-only Low Emission Zone (LEZ) that could push more polluting traffic to other parts of the City, while Lib Dems call for an Edinburgh-wide LEZ covering goods vehicles, buses and coaches.

Lib Dems push for more zebra crossings

At yesterday's City of Edinburgh Council meeting, Morningside Councillor Neil Ross persuaded the Council to improve pedestrian access across Edinburgh cost-effectively.

Key mental health targets breached for 168,000 people

Scottish Liberal Democrat leader Alex Cole-Hamilton today marked ten years since Scotland’s mental health waiting targets were introduced by revealing that they have been breached for at least 168,128 people on the SNP Government’s watch.
